# Cold Storage Archival — notes for the weekly eng sync (Team Permafrost)
# This config governs the nightly sweep that moves buckets untouched for 180+
# days from the Tarnwell hot tier into Glacierpoint cold storage. Please review
# ARCHIVE_BATCH_SIZE carefully before changing it; batches over 500 objects
# have caused manifest timeouts twice this quarter. Restores must go through
# the ops queue, never directly. The sweep job authenticates to the
# Glacierpoint API with the key declared on the next line.

secret setting of kagug-tajep: COURIER_KEY8=e81a8675

# Seat-map renderer constants — StageGrid module
#
# These values control how the Marlowe Playhouse seat map is drawn in the
# booking widget. Support staff: if customers report overlapping seats or
# blurry section labels, the usual cause is a venue layout exceeding the
# default grid bounds, not a browser issue. Changing these constants
# requires a cache flush on the render workers, so coordinate with the
# on-call engineer before editing. The current tuning constants are
# listed below.

limits module of tageg-tajog:
QUOTAS = {
    "kasax": 140,
    "wenath": 802,
}

Subject: Deep-link router key rotation — heads up

Hi,

Quick note before your review: we rotated the credentials for the Larkspool deep-link routing service this morning. The old key stops working Friday, so the mobile team has already swapped it in the Fernway and Tidemark apps. Routing behavior is unchanged — same path matching, same fallback to the web view. For your verification pass, the new key is below.

gateway credential: kto3_qfe